Anthology. Critical essays examining the origin, history & capabilies of Spetsnaz --- Russian Special Purpose Forces (or Special Purpose Military Units), employed in many post-Soviet states. Special military unitts controlled by the military intelligence service GRU (Spetsnaz GRU). Volume gives special attention its role in the Afghan war. 308 pgs w/tables, diagrams & maps w/biographical sketch of contributors in 14 chapters: 1, Assessing Spetnaz; 2, Western Misconceptions; 3, Historical Precedent; 4, The Spanish Civil War; 5, Spetsnaz Engineers in the Great Patriotic War: An Overviewr; 6. The Far North Origin of Naval Spetsnaz; 7, The Artic: Petsamo-Kirkenes, 7-10th, Oct, 1944; 8, Manchuria, 1945; 9, Spetsnaz & Soviet Far North Strategy; 10, Prague to Kabul; 11,… Read More
